DOOR REMOVAL
If door must be removed:
• Unplug the unit
• Gently lay refrigerator on its back, on a rug or blanket.
• Remove two base screws and base panel. Remove wire from
clips on bottom of cabinet, if required.
• Unplug connector, if required, by holding the cabinet connector
in place and pulling the door connector out.
• Remove the bottom hinge screws.
• Remove the plastic top hinge cover.
• Remove the screws from the top hinge.
• Remove the top hinge from the cabinet.
• Remove the door and bottom hinge from the cabinet.
• To replace door, reverse the above procedures and securely
tighten all screws to prevent hinge slippage.

SETTING THE TEMPERATURE CONTROL

COOL DOWN PERIOD
For safe food storage, allow four (4) hours for refrigerator to cool
down completely. The refrigerator will run continuously for the
first several hours.
ELECTRONIC TEMPERATURE CONTROL
The electronic temperature control is located inside the
refrigerator. Temperature is factory preset to provide satisfactory
food storage temperatures. However, the temperature control is
adjustable to provide a range of temperatures for your personal
satisfaction. To adjust the temperature setting, move the UP ( )
button for warmer temperature and DOWN ( ) button for colder
temperature on the control panel. Allow several hours for the
temperature to stabilize between adjustments.

REFRIGERATOR FEATURES

INTERIOR LIGHTING
The light comes on automatically when the door is opened. The
light bulb assembly is located on the back of the refrigerator
control box. To replace the light bulb, turn the temperature control
to "OFF" and unplug the electrical cord. Replace the old bulb
with a bulb of the same type and wattage.
SPILL PROOF SLIDE-OUT GLASS SHELVING
Multi-position adjustable slide out glass shelves can be moved
to any position for larger or smaller packages. The shipping
spacers that stabilize the shelves for shipping may be removed
and discarded.
TO ADJUST THE SHELVES
NOTE
Cantilever shelves are supported at the back of the refrigerator.
• Lift front edge up.
• Pull shelf out
• Replace the shelf by inserting the hooks at rear of the shelf into
the wall bracket. Lower the shelf into the desired slots and lock
into position.
